Pay in context

Top pay as a share of expenses

In 2024, the highest total compensation at F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ION equaled 2% of the organization's total expenses. The median for phil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ations is 15%.

This organization (2024)
2%
Sector median
15%
Middle half of sector
5% to 24%

Based on 35,946 phil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

FAQ

Common questions about F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ION

What does the Chief Executive Officer of F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ION earn?

In 2024, the Chief Executive Officer of F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ION received $93,413 in total compensation. This pay is above the median (the midpoint) for Chief Executive Officer roles among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king organizations in Wisconsin, within the top half of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.

How does Chief Executive Officer pay at F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ION compare with similar nonprofits?

Compared with the same role at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king organizations in Wisconsin, the 2024 pay of the Chief Executive Officer at F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ION falls between the median and the 75th percentile. In 2024, the highest total compensation at F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ION equaled 2% of the organization's total expenses. The median for phil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ations is 15%.

What are F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ION's revenue and expenses?

In 2024, FARMING FOR THE FUTURE FOUNDATION reported $4.3M in total revenue and $5.5M in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
